House tuckpointing services involve the careful repair and restoration of mortar joints between bricks or stones on a building’s exterior. Over time, mortar can deteriorate due to exposure to the elements, leading to cracks, crumbling, or gaps that compromise the structural integrity and appearance of a property. Skilled contractors remove the damaged mortar and replace it with fresh, durable material that matches the original in color and texture. This process not only enhances the visual appeal of the building but also helps prevent further deterioration caused by water infiltration and freeze-thaw cycles.

This service is especially valuable for addressing common problems such as crumbling mortar, cracked joints, or loose bricks. When mortar begins to decay, it can allow water to seep into the wall, which may lead to more serious issues like mold growth, wood rot, or even structural instability. Tuckpointing can effectively seal these vulnerable areas, protecting the property from weather-related damage and extending the lifespan of the masonry. The overview below groups typical House Tuckpointing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Louisville,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tuckpointing jobs, such as fixing small cracks or damaged mortar,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ed.

Standard Repointing - Replacing or restoring mortar on an entire wall section usually costs between $1,000-$3,000. Most projects of this size stay within this range, with fewer reaching higher amounts for more extensive work.

Full Tuckpointing - Complete tuckpointing of a large brick facade can range from $3,500-$8,000+. Larger, more complex projects may exceed this range, but many jobs are completed within the mid-tier prices.

Full Replacement - When brick or stone needs to be replaced entirely, costs typically start around $5,000 and can go beyond $15,000 for extensive or multi-story projects. These are less common and usually reserved for significant structural issues.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is tuckpointing and how does it improve my home's exterior? Tuckpointing involves repairing and restoring the mortar joints between bricks or stones, helping to enhance the appearance and structural integrity of a house’s exterior in Louisville, OH and nearby areas.

Why should I consider tuckpointing for my house’s chimneys or walls? Tuckpointing can prevent water infiltration, reduce deterioration caused by weather, and extend the lifespan of brickwork on chimneys and exterior walls.

How do I find local contractors who specialize in tuckpointing services? You can contact service providers in Louisville, OH and surrounding areas who focus on masonry and tuckpointing to compare options and find the right fit for your project.

What are common signs that my brickwork needs tuckpointing? Visible cracks, crumbling mortar, or water stains on brick surfaces are indicators that tuckpointing may be necessary to maintain your home's integrity.

Can tuckpointing be done on historic or older homes? Yes, experienced local contractors can perform tuckpointing on historic or older homes to help preserve their appearance while reinforcing the structure.
